Why is my floor 'dry to the touch' but your meter says it's still wet?

Surface evaporation creates a 'dry' feel, but trapped moisture in the subfloor maintains high vapor pressure. The IICRC S500 standard for Hamilton City Core requ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ium of 40 GPP (Grains Per Pound) at 70°F. We achieve this with targeted airflow and dehumidification, not just surface drying.

What should I do first when I find a major leak in my house?

Immediately locate and shut off the main water valve to stop the intrusion. This is the first step in 'loss of use' mitigation. For properties near Hamilton City Plaza, know your valve's location beforehand. Then contact your utility provider for emergency service and your restoration provider.

How long do I have before mold starts growing from water damage?

Microbial amplification can begin within the 48-72 hour window post-intrusion. By 2026, insurance carriers view mitigation delays beyond this window as a failure in the 'standard of care,' potentially shifting liability for resulting mold remediation costs to the property owner. Timely, documented response is critical.

What's the difference between 'clean' and 'black' water damage for my claim?

Category 1 ('clean') water is from a sanitary source. Category 3 ('black') water is grossly contaminated and poses a health hazard, requiring more extensive remediation.
